Transaction 7956cafc91e64d15766d959bdf4a6b998f7687462ceeebb4b150700e8068f0bc
1 Input
2 Outputs
- 7956cafc91e64d15766d959bdf4a6b998f7687462ceeebb4b150700e8068f0bc:0
- 7956cafc91e64d15766d959bdf4a6b998f7687462ceeebb4b150700e8068f0bc:1
value 10750000
address 3Hp2QBwGYQnnW5sbvLEz6sMw8r8wyBKrqh
value 140904129
address 3DMytwmpjqVDaRiVxh749mhw7U1x3daJbB